Transaction 21e402955250b15a858e97a3e48e6bbaa27e8aac1d93bc6b1d7c0d1a295cdab7
1 Input
1 Output
-
21e402955250b15a858e97a3e48e6bbaa27e8aac1d93bc6b1d7c0d1a295cdab7:0
- value
- 31977879
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e44f54cc7ee3f0b4530de5792aadca4888b5cd30 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MpC6mbZj5caYxzVU6mhZ2w3ctxdARDu8n